La Toscana: Gay Venues
Florence has drawn gay and lesbian travellers for a long time, however, it wasn’t until 1970 that the city got its first gay disco, TABASCO, right in the historic heart of Florence. At around the same time, the Fronte Unitario Omosessuale Rivoluzionario Italiano or (FUORI), Italian for “out”, Tuscany’s first gay and lesbian organisation, was set up by members of the radical party. For gay men there are lots of “cruising” areas, although some can be more dangerous than others. The “Parco delle Cascine” and the area around “Campo di Marte” are the most well-known. Police are strict here and there are regular ID checks carried out. The age of consent is 18 in bars and clubs and it is worth bringing ID with you to be on the safe side.
